The motor ring 3 is a ring road in the north-west of Copenhagen . It forms a half-ring and provides a connection from the Køge Bugt Motorvejen to Helsingørmotorvejen . It is also used by commuters as an important axis in Copenhagen and is the busiest road in Denmark with around 75,000 vehicles a day. It is part of the full length of the M3 and the European routes E47 and E55 .
State of development
The motorway was expanded to three lanes from MK Kongens Lyngby to MK Brøndby by 2010.
history
The road was built in seven stages between 1966 and 1980, mostly with two lanes, although the plans go back much further.
